Buck Privates
"Swing it!"
Originally released in 1941. Buck Privates is a comedy/music film. directed by Arthur Lubin. At just 84 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Bud Abbott, Lou Costello, and Lee Bowman
Synopsis
Petty con artists Slicker Smith and Herbie Brown mistakenly join the Army evading the cops. The cop chasing them winds up as their drill instructor. A rich young man and his former working class chauffeur are not only in the same unit, they're vying for a pretty girl who seems attracted to both.
